Industrial Power and Marine Ltd: UK visa sponsorship
Yes, Industrial Power and Marine Ltd holds a UK Home Office sponsor licence.
It appears on the official register of licensed sponsors, registered in Burton on Trent. A licence means the employer can sponsor eligible roles, it does not mean every job it advertises comes with sponsorship. Always confirm for the specific role, and verify on gov.uk.

Industrial Power and Marine Ltd sponsorship: common questions
Does Industrial Power and Marine Ltd sponsor UK work visas?
Yes. Industrial Power and Marine Ltd appears on the UK Home Office register of licensed sponsors, which means it is licensed to sponsor workers on the Skilled Worker route. Holding a licence means the employer can sponsor eligible roles; it does not guarantee that any specific job comes with sponsorship, so always confirm for the role you are applying to.
Where is Industrial Power and Marine Ltd registered as a sponsor?
On the register, Industrial Power and Marine Ltd is listed in Burton on Trent. Employers can sponsor staff working anywhere they operate, not only at the registered address.
Which visa routes can Industrial Power and Marine Ltd sponsor?
Industrial Power and Marine Ltd is licensed for: Global Business Mobility: Senior or Specialist Worker, Skilled Worker. Each route has its own eligibility and salary rules set by the Home Office.
How do I check Industrial Power and Marine Ltd's sponsor licence myself?
Search for "Industrial Power and Marine Ltd" in the official register of licensed sponsors on gov.uk. The register is the authoritative source and is updated regularly, including when a licence is added, suspended or revoked.
